Transaction 95877cf6a6627e83b024c28c2f41ce5c0643c710ec7a878bfb7d35e90d1e7805
1 Input
-
344785185b86d24d0fb82cdcc24681f0d63695413099de98776fc0b6937b4b90:0
OP_DATA_48(48) 4402202813ed5f1dcb050e5758b1e49db1f4cdcbaf03ef317221d1fac33b5fb582cae9022070d324e5fa77262af06473
1 Outputs
- 95877cf6a6627e83b024c28c2f41ce5c0643c710ec7a878bfb7d35e90d1e7805:0
value 422552
address 3F2ezCTw86bqfkcZzLgiHYJ76BF4NHFMKS